Fremantle has appointed Neil Ross as its Western recruiting manager.

The 46-year-old’s recruiting duties will cover Western Australia, South Australia and the Northern Territory.

He was West Coast’s development coach in
2005-2006, and for the past three years has been Collingwood’s WA recruiting manager.

Lloyd said that Adam Jones, the club’s current Melbourne-based recruiting operations manager, had been appointed Eastern recruiting manager.

Jones, whose recruiting duties will cover Victoria, New South Wales, Queensland and Tasmania, will also report to the club’s general manager of player management.
